Hotel
Top Rated
Urban Sea Hotel Atocha 113
, Madrid, Spain
At a Glance
Type
Hotel
Star Rating
1.0 stars
Guest Score
8.5/10
Reviews
48
Region
Europe
Amenities
Free WiFi
Concierge
About This Hotel
Urban Sea Hotel Atocha 113 provides flawless service and all the necessary facilities for visitors.Stay connected with your associates, as complimentary Wi-Fi is available during your entire visit. The hotel offers reception amenities including concierge service, luggage storage and safety deposit boxes to ensure a comfortable stay for guests.Smoking is permitted solely in the specified smoking zones allocated by hotel.
π₯ Special Offer
Get up to 75% OFF on Agoda
Exclusive member deals available
Best Price Guarantee
Free Cancellation Options
Secure Booking
π° Compare prices from 2M+ hotels worldwide on Agoda
Official Agoda Partner
Location: Madrid, Spain
ποΈ Nearby Attractions
Things to do near Urban Sea Hotel Atocha 113
β Guest Reviews
Loading reviews...



